    Holy Smoke BBQ Expands Restaurant in Gahanna

    You may be familiar with Holy Smoke BBQ through their North Market stall or their popular food truck, but you may not realize that their Gahanna location on North Hamilton Road has recently expanded to offer dine in service to customers looking for a more complete restaurant experience.

    “We wanted to make our customers’ experience at Holy Smoke easier and even more enjoyable,” says Stan Riley, owner of Holy Smoke. “Now you can come in with your family, sit down and relax while we bring the BBQ right to you.”

    Holy Smoke was originally established as Yoho’s Catering in 1983. Stan Riley joined the company in 1993, introducing smoked and barbecued meats to the business. After taking over in 2005, Riley rebranded the business as Holy Smoke in 2007 with the launch of the original North Market retail location. The business expanded with a second retail location in Gahanna in 2011.

    The new full-service Holy Smoke BBQ restaurant is located at 5251 North Hamilton Road.
